The Australia Josamycin Drug Market was estimated at USD 240 Million in 2025 and is projected to reach USD 282 Million by 2032, growing at a CAGR of 2.3% from 2026 to 2032. This growth trajectory is largely propelled by the increasing incidence of bacterial infections and the heightened awareness surrounding antibiotic resistance, prompting healthcare providers to seek effective treatment alternatives. Josamycin's effectiveness against resistant strains further positions it as a key player in the evolving landscape of antibiotic therapy in Australia.
The Australian Josamycin drug market exhibited a modest decline of -0.5% in 2021, primarily due to temporary disruptions resulting from the pandemic and a shift towards alternative therapies. However, this trajectory reversed in 2022 with a robust growth of 5.3%, fueled by increasing consumer demand and investments in healthcare infrastructure. The market maintained a solid growth pattern through 2023, recording 5.1%, as pharmaceutical companies intensified research and development efforts and expanded distribution channels. Although growth is projected to moderate to 2.6% in 2024 and further taper to 1.7% by 2025, a gradual recovery is anticipated as the market stabilizes, supported by ongoing advancements in medical technology and a resilient healthcare policy framework.

In Australia, the josamycin drug market is characterized by its significant role in treating a variety of bacterial infections, including respiratory and skin ailments. With the rise in bacterial resistance, the demand for effective antibiotics like josamycin has gained unprecedented importance among healthcare practitioners.
Recent trends indicate a shift towards broad-spectrum antibiotics, as physicians increasingly turn to drugs that can combat resistant infections. This market adaptation underscores the critical role that josamycin plays in the broader context of public health and the ongoing battle against infectious diseases.
Despite the promising growth trajectory, the Australia josamycin drug market faces significant restraints. The pervasive issue of antibiotic resistance presents a dual challenge: ensuring the continued efficacy of josamycin while addressing the healthcare community's demand for alternative antibiotics. Concerns around drug availability and affordability also hinder market accessibility. Furthermore, regulatory compliance can be complex and burdensome for manufacturers, particularly amidst increasing pricing pressures and competition. Thus, fostering collaboration among stakeholders remains essential in navigating these challenges effectively.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
